**J-Clips:** J-clips are a popular choice due to their simplicity and ease of installation. They are typically made of metal and shaped like a "J," with the longer portion extending behind the mirror and the shorter hook gripping the bottom edge. J-clips are best suited for lighter mirrors and offer minimal adjustability. They are often used in conjunction with adhesive for added security.
**L-Brackets:** Similar to J-clips, L-brackets offer a slightly more robust mounting solution. The 90-degree angle provides additional support, making them suitable for slightly heavier mirrors. L-brackets are typically used in pairs, one on each side of the mirror, and may also be used with adhesive for added stability.
**Z-Clips:** Z-clips offer a more concealed mounting method. These clips consist of two interlocking pieces, one attached to the wall and the other to the back of the mirror. When the mirror is pushed onto the wall-mounted piece, the two parts interlock, securing the mirror in place. Z-clips are suitable for medium-weight mirrors and offer a clean, minimalist look.
**D-Rings and Wire:** This method involves attaching D-rings to the back of the mirror and suspending it from hooks or screws on the wall using wire. This is a more traditional method and is suitable for heavier mirrors. However, it requires more precise measurements and careful installation to ensure the mirror hangs level.
**French Cleats:** French cleats offer a strong and versatile mounting solution for heavier mirrors. They consist of two interlocking pieces, one attached to the wall and the other to the back of the mirror. The angled design creates a secure grip, distributing the weight evenly. French cleats are particularly useful for large or oversized mirrors.
**Mirror Adhesive:** While not a bracket in itself, mirror adhesive is often used in conjunction with various bracket types to provide additional support and prevent movement. It is crucial to select an adhesive specifically designed for mirrors to avoid damaging the backing.
Several factors influence the selection of appropriate bathroom mirror mounting brackets. The size and weight of the mirror are primary considerations. Heavier mirrors necessitate more robust brackets, while lighter mirrors can be supported by simpler options. The desired aesthetic is also important. Some brackets offer a more concealed mounting solution, while others are more visible.
The wall material also plays a crucial role in bracket selection. Different wall materials require different types of anchors and screws. For example, drywall requires specialized anchors to prevent the brackets from pulling out. Consulting with a hardware professional can be beneficial in determining the appropriate anchors for a specific wall type.
Proper installation is crucial for ensuring the safety and stability of the mounted mirror. Accurate measurements are essential for proper placement and alignment. Using the correct tools and following the manufacturer's instructions are vital for a secure installation. If unsure about any aspect of the installation process, consulting a professional installer is recommended.
Maintaining bathroom mirror mounting brackets involves regular inspection for signs of wear or damage. Tightening loose screws and replacing damaged brackets promptly are essential for preventing accidents. Cleaning the brackets periodically can also prevent corrosion and maintain their appearance.
